Music Performance Concentration (CA): Home
The Music Performance concentration fosters individual expression and the development of performance skills. Performance students have the opportunity to perform in a wide range of music ensembles and as solo artists. This concentration also provides a foundation for students who wish to pursue K-12 music teaching.
Vocalists are encouraged to explore styles from contemporary to classical. Most singers participate in one of Ramapo's five vocal ensembles and the Musical Theater Workshop presents an original staged showcase each year. Emphasis at Ramapo is on development of the "whole singer" and students are supported in developing unique performance interests and projects.
Instrumentalists have opportunities to experience music making in contemporary, popular, jazz, classical, rock, and computer-interactive ensembles. Individual lessons with outstanding performer-teachers are available on campus for voice, guitar, bass, piano and strings. Off-campus instruction taking advantage of our proximity to New York is also supported.
What is a Concentration?
A concentration is a focus on a more targeted field of the major. Some majors have concentrations in which you choose your course of study. These majors include Business Administration, Communication Arts, Music, and Social Science.
